I just got a SD600.1 and I want to mount it under my seat it fits with a little room to spare but I have a question. Can I screw it down to the floor of the car ? I don't want it to ground out if I screw it to the car. The reason I ask is I all ways have mounted my amps to wood I never thought about putting it under the seat before until I saw this little amp.

I hope that if we are installing pg gear that we are above using velcro in an attempt to mount it.
There should be no issue with mounting it to the floor, just look underneath and make sure you are clear of fuel lines or other stuff that do not like to be poked.

I suggest you look for some stainless steel sheetmetal screws to mount it with.
Based on where in the world you are located, the portion of the screw sticking under the vehicle can rust off in as little as a year depending on conditions. Then your amp will end up loose.

Get either 1/8 or 1/4" wood and cut it out to be1"longer on all sides and slip that under the carpet then screw the amp to the wood. Wont go anywhere.
